description In view of the security threats such as forgery,deception,privacy disclosure and non-traceability caused by the lack of transaction supervision for crowdsourcing logistics in the modern service industry,a blockchain-based hierarchical and multi-level smart service transaction supervision framework for crowdsourcing logistics was proposed.Firstly,the framework adopted the two-stage supervision system:one was the National Authorized Certification Center for the supervision of logistics service platform,the other was the logistics service platform for the supervision of crowdsourcing logistics participation.Later,under the framework of the supervision system,the functions of crowd contract,legal and anonymous identity authentication,intelligent transaction matching,anomaly data analysis and detection,privacy protection and traceability were realized.Then,through the security analysis and transaction supervision component software,the security controllability and operational efficiency of the transaction supervision architecture were verified.Finally,the software component was run on the real crowdsourcing logistics enterprise platform for the actual measurement.The measurement results show that the proposed hierarchical and multi-level smart service transaction supervision framework is safe and controllable.The framework can protect the privacy of users and data,prevent forgery and deception,and realize the auditability and traceability of behaviors and data of users.
